So tomorrow

Serbia vs. South Sudan
PR vs. China

technically, Serbia CAN be eliminated (tie breaker is how many points you score if it's a 3 way tie, but it's unlikely. PR would have to win, Serbia would have to lose and PR would have to outscore Serbia by 23.

Greece vs. New Zealand

loser is out of the WC, if New Zealand loses, Australia clinches their Olympic bid

Brazil vs. Cote d'Ivoire

loser is out of the WC

Out of South Sudan, Cape Verde and Cote d'Ivoire, if any one of them advances alone, they secure the Africa bid for the Olympics.

in fairness, in pool play, the scores kinda matter. The teams who don't advance, the stats carry over to the next pool to determine ranking and where they place.

If you finish outside of the 16 eligible teams who will have to qualify again next year, your Olympic hopes are gone.

Yeah it's 1 from Asia, 1 from Africa, 1 from Oceania, 2 from Europe, 2 from Americas, The host country, and then 4 spots from the winners of the last chance tourneys next summer

The South American teams really get fukked by having everything be "The Americas".

Between Canada, the US, and now teams like DR, Bahamas and whoever else can bring in NBA guys, we might not see a south American team in the Olympics for a while
